Osage Orange season is Spring, Summer and Fall and Tulip Tree season is Spring, Summer and Fall. The type of soil for Osage Orange is Clay, Loam and for Tulip Tree is Clay, Loam while the PH of soil for Osage Orange is Acidic, Neutral, Alkaline and for Tulip Tree is Acidic, Neutral.
